Respone to internvention (RTI) as proposed special education legislation is mean to prevent and address the literacy and learning difficult of students. - RTI as a system of progress monitoring and responsive interventions for secondary literacy is still in need of validication. - There are few partical models of RTI for secondary literacy. - RTI at the secondary level may be possible if reframeled as a comprehensive program that provides responsi literacy instruction to students at all ability levels, where they are learning disable or not.
